BALTIMORE - Sept. 2, 2021 - (PHOTO RELEASE) Northrop Grumman Corporation (NYSE: NOC) has delivered its 15th AN/TPS-80 Ground/Air Task Oriented Radar (G/ATOR) Active Electronically Scanned Array (AESA) multi-mission radar system to the U.S. Marine Corps, completing the low-rate initial production phase of the program. The team recently fielded the first full-rate production system to the Marine Corps and will continue deliveries through 2024. Providing enhanced mission capabilities, software upgrades and logistics support are expected to continue through G/ATOR's 30-year lifetime.
